Transaction af423b07be2e62a2d58e80980e10efa5cc7c25f0abc2a7393cd3febc95383d68
1 Input
1 Output
-
af423b07be2e62a2d58e80980e10efa5cc7c25f0abc2a7393cd3febc95383d68:0
- value
- 129894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23a434c6180970a2bbe921921a30f676feec3615 OP_EQUAL
- address
- 34wUHW1Y9BDem6gMUhzwyo83iAX6kSrzMj